StudyBuddy — Your (Unhelpfully) Helpful Study Companion
StudyBuddy is a lighthearted Python package that adds sarcasm, pep talks, and playful structure to your study routine. It gives you randomized study tips, motivational messages, funny excuses, and silly study plans to make your academic life a bit more entertaining.

Installation
From PyPI (recommended):
pip install studybuddy
From source:
git clone https://github.com/swe-students-fall2025/3-python-package-team_cedar.git
cd 3-python-package-team_cedar
pip install -e .
Quick Start (Import & Use)
from studybuddy import study_tip, motivate, excuse, study_plan
# Get a humorous study tip
print(study_tip("physics", "chaotic"))
# Get some motivation (sarcastic or genuine)
print(motivate("sarcastic"))
# Get a funny excuse
print(excuse("homework"))
# Generate a study plan
for step in study_plan(3, "high", seed=4):
print(step)
API Reference (All Functions)
All functions accept an optional seed parameter for reproducible randomness.
study_tip(topic="math", mood="chaotic", seed=None) -> str
Returns a humorous study tip for the given topic.
Parameters:
topic(str): The subject area. Options:"math","physics","history". Unknown topics default to"math".mood(str): Currently unused, reserved for future expansion. Default:"chaotic".seed(int | None): Optional seed for reproducible results.
Returns: A string containing a humorous study tip.
Example:
from studybuddy import study_tip
print(study_tip("physics", "chaotic"))
# Output: "If it moves, it's probably physics. If not, hit it again."
print(study_tip("math", seed=42))
# Output: "If it's too complex, assume x = 0. Problem solved."
motivate(style="sarcastic", seed=None) -> str
Returns a motivational or sarcastic message to keep you going.
Parameters:
style(str): The tone of motivation. Options:"sarcastic","genuine". Unknown styles default to"sarcastic".seed(int | None): Optional seed for reproducible results.
Returns: A string containing a motivational message.
Example:
from studybuddy import motivate
print(motivate("sarcastic"))
# Output: "Remember: diamonds are made under pressure. So start panicking."
print(motivate("genuine"))
# Output: "One page at a time — just keep going."
excuse(reason="homework", seed=None) -> str
Returns a funny excuse for various academic mishaps.
Parameters:
reason(str): The situation needing an excuse. Options:"homework","late","exam". Unknown reasons default to"homework".seed(int | None): Optional seed for reproducible results.
Returns: A string containing a humorous excuse.
Example:
from studybuddy import excuse
print(excuse("homework"))
# Output: "My cat deleted my assignment. She's learning cybersecurity."
print(excuse("exam"))
# Output: "I didn't fail. I just found 99 ways that didn't work."
print(excuse("late"))
# Output: "My Wi-Fi connected to another dimension."
study_plan(hours=3, caffeine_level="high", seed=None) -> list[str]
Generates a humorous study plan with steps.
Parameters:
hours(int): Number of hours to plan for. Range: 1–5 (values above 5 are clamped to 5). Default: 3.caffeine_level(str): Caffeine consumption level. Options:"low","high". When"high", adds coffee-related steps. Default:"high".seed(int | None): Optional seed for reproducible results.
Returns: A list of strings, each representing a study step.
Example:
from studybuddy import study_plan
plan = study_plan(3, "high", seed=4)
for step in plan:
print(step)
# Output:
# Step 1: Drink more coffee. Make coffee.
# Step 2: Drink more coffee. Open your notes.
# Step 3: Panic productively for 90 minutes.
# With low caffeine
plan = study_plan(2, "low", seed=10)
for step in plan:
print(step)
# Output:
# Step 1: Reward yourself with a snack break.
# Step 2: Google half the material.
Example Program
See the complete working example at example.py:
from studybuddy import study_tip, motivate, excuse, study_plan
def main():
print("=== StudyBuddy Demo ===")
print("\nStudy Tip:", study_tip("physics", "chaotic"))
print("\nMotivation:", motivate("sarcastic"))
print("\nExcuse:", excuse("homework"))
print("\nStudy Plan:")
for step in study_plan(3, "high", seed=4):
print(" -", step)
if __name__ == "__main__":
main()
Run it:
python example.py
Sample output:
=== StudyBuddy Demo ===
Study Tip: If it moves, it's probably physics. If not, hit it again.
Motivation: Remember: diamonds are made under pressure. So start panicking.
Excuse: My cat deleted my assignment. She's learning cybersecurity.
Study Plan:
- Step 1: Drink more coffee. Make coffee.
- Step 2: Drink more coffee. Open your notes.
- Step 3: Panic productively for 90 minutes.
Contributing
We welcome contributions! Follow this workflow to contribute to the project.
Set up your development environment
Clone the repository:
git clone https://github.com/swe-students-fall2025/3-python-package-team_cedar.git
cd 3-python-package-team_cedar
Create a virtual environment:
# Option 1: venv (recommended)
python -m venv .venv
source .venv/bin/activate # On Windows: .venv\Scripts\activate
# Option 2: Pipenv
pip install pipenv
pipenv install --dev
pipenv shell
Install dependencies:
pip install -U pip
pip install -e . pytest build twine
Run tests
pytest -q
All tests should pass before submitting a pull request.
Build the package
python -m build
This creates distribution files in the ./dist directory.
Publish to PyPI (maintainer only)
twine upload dist/*
Git workflow for new features
- Create a feature branch:
git switch -c feat/your-feature-name
-
Make changes and add tests for any new functionality
-
Commit your changes:
git add -A
git commit -m "feat(core): add your feature description"
- Push to GitHub:
git push -u origin feat/your-feature-name
- Open a Pull Request on GitHub
- Request a teammate review
- After approval, merge into
main - Delete your feature branch
Continuous Integration
Every pull request triggers automated testing via GitHub Actions on Python 3.10 and 3.11.
The CI badge at the top of this README shows the current build status.
Workflow file: .github/workflows/event-logger.yml
